Opinion

PER CURIAM:

The judgment is affirmed for the reasons stated by the trial judge, Judge Orrick, in his opinion. Northern California Supermarkets, Inc. v. Central California Lettuce Producers Cooperative, et al., N.D.Cal., 1976, 413 F.Supp. 984. See also, the opinion of the Federal Trade Commission in the matter of Central California Lettuce Producers Cooperative, et al., Docket No. 8970, July 25, 1977, C.C.H. Trade Regulation Reports, ¶ 21,337.

Affirmed.
